Djuma Bush Lodge Description


Located in the Sabi Sands Private Game Reserve Djuma Bush Lodge is a traditional bush lodge and has maintained its self as a down to earth lodge, much like many lodges used to before plunge pools, cellars and bush spas were invented! Bush Lodge is primarily a family lodge and comprises of eight thatched chalets all with en-suite rooms, air-conditioning, overhead fans and mosquito nets. The main building is an impressive open thatched construction with two viewing decks. It overlooks the pool next to the watering hole.

Bush Lodge has operated for more than ten years and is famous for its easy, friendly family atmosphere. A reputation over the past ten years for a relaxed, unpretentious atmosphere encourages guests to truly relax and become one of the Djuma family . Lunch is a simple affair: with hot and cold dishes, and afternoon tea includes fresh bakes. Sumptuous dinners are either served in the dining room or under the African sky, around a roaring fire in the boma.
The pool is in a small grove of Tamboti trees and is always delightfully cool. There are two viewing decks over the water-hole. Morning safaris start early so as not to miss the magic of the African sunrise and most animals are active at this time of day.

Djuma Bush Lodge : A Typical Day on Safari


At 05h00 you are woken by knocking on the doors (only if one wishes of course !)  Walk through to guest area and enjoy morning tea and muffins with your ranger. Your ranger will try and encourage you and the other guests to be ready to leave by 05h45 to catch the sunrise and animal viewing. By the time you return from the morning game drive all the morning staff are at camp, where there breakfast is ready from 08h30 – 09h00. After breakfast enjoy a walk depending on your personal fitness levels it is normally ± 1 to 1½ hours.

The game rangers offer fauna and flora lectures and magnificent rock art viewing.  Each topic is discussed and guests are welcome to set the pace as they wish. There is of course always the good possibility of game viewing on foot.  On returning to the lodge, one can relax in the room or wallow in the pool before a scrumptious relaxed lunch. The big game drive starts at 16h30, with coolbox sundowners and snacks. The ranger stops to watch the sun going down in Africa. You return back to Djuma Bush Lodge at 20h30 – 21h00  where dinner is served at the boma or in the dining area.

Djuma Bush Lodge  is located in the Sabi Sands Game Reserve, this reserve has a common boundary with the Kruger National Park. The lodge is a 5 -6 hour drive from Johannesburg. Alternatively direct flights direct from Johannesburg arrive daily, and scheduled flight to Hoedspruit Airport operate daily. Rhino Africa can organise flights and transfers on your behalf.
